Private Banks HDFC Bank opens branch in Coimbatore L.N. Revathy
Coimbatore , Jan. 25 THE second branch of HDFC Bank was inaugurated in Coimbatore recently, taking its branch network in the State to 18. It's Regional Business Manager (Andhra Pradesh and Tamil Nadu), Mr C. S. Gopinath, on the sidelines of opening up this branch told this correspondent that the introduction of newer branches was aimed at strengthening its network and presence in all major cities across the country. The bank has a countrywide presence of 275 branches across 147 locations. It has over 750 ATMs apart from the ATM sharing tie-up with State Bank of India (SBI). While briefing about the array of products that the bank offered, Mr Gopinath said the banks in general, were not craving for fixed deposits but were looking at low cost funds such as current account and savings bank account as profitable propositions.
